Offensive team based around the sweeping mexican
Hi,
I've decided to build a team which is based aroung my favourite Pokemon Ludicolo and because I don't like stall wars, I've come up with an offensive one that has resistances to each type.
My team at a glance:
______________________________________________________________
Gyarados @ Leftovers
Trait: Intimidate
EVs: 216 HP / 16 Atk / 178 Def / 100 Spd
Adamant Nature (+Atk, -SAtk)
-Waterfall
-Earthquake
-Dragon Dance
-Taunt
BulkyGyara is my lead. It does well against Heracross which counters my Ludicolo otherwise. Because of Electivire, it only fears Rock Attacks, namely Stone Edge from another Gyarados.
Electivire @ Expert Belt
Trait: Motor Drive
EVs: 252 Atk / 176 Spd / 82 SAtk
Lonely Nature (+Atk, -Def)
-Thunderbolt
-Ice Punch
-Cross Chop
-Earthquake
Electivire is my wall breaker because it counters Blissey and Skarmory effectively. Both of them would cripple my Ludicolo.
Forretress @ Leftovers
Trait: Sturdy
EVs: 252 HP / 162 Atk / 96 Def
Relaxed Nature (+Def, -Spd)
-Gyro Ball
-Zap Cannon
-Stealth Rock
-Rapid Spin
Forretress gives my team Rapid Spin and Stealth Rock support. With Zap Cannon, it counters Gyarados. My physical wall.
Ludicolo @ Leftovers
Trait: Swift Swim
EVs: 154 HP / 104 Spd / 252 SAtk
Modest nature (+SAtk, -Atk)
-Surf
-Grass Knot
-Ice Beam
-Rain Dance
The core of my team. After a Rain Dance, this can easily sweep entire teams as soon as their special walls are defeated.
Snorlax @ Leftovers
Trait: Thick Fat
EVs: 244 HP / 28 Def / 238 SDef
Careful Nature (+SDef, -SAtk)
-Body Slam
-Crunch
-Sleep Talk
-Rest
STalkLax is my special wall (, but a more offensive orientated one than Blissey) and my status absorber. I need Shadow Ball here to counter Gengar which would otherwise run through my whole team.
Garchomp @ Choice Scarf
Trait: Sand Veil
EVs: 252 Atk / 252 Spd / 6 SDef
Adamant Nature (+Atk, -SAtk)
-Outrage
-Earthquake
-Crunch
-Fire Blast
Garchomp, my Revenge Killer. It resists Rock and Electric attacks, so it does well together with Gyarados.
